The Story of Charisma
Charisma comes directly from the Greek word 'charis' meaning grace or favor, specifically divine grace or a gift freely given by God. In early Christian theology, charismata were spiritual gifts bestowed by the Holy Spirit. The modern English meaning of personal magnetism evolved from this original theological sense of divine gifting.
Charisma is rarely used as a given name, though it appears occasionally in communities where virtue names and inspirational word names are popular. Actress Charisma Carpenter brought the name to public awareness through her role on Buffy the Vampire Slayer.
In Pentecostal and charismatic Christian traditions, charisma refers specifically to spiritual gifts. As a given name, it carries both the spiritual meaning of divine grace and the secular meaning of exceptional personal appeal.
